intrachromosomally

English edit

Etymology edit

intrachromosomal +‎ -ly = intra- +‎ chromosome +‎ -ally

Adverb edit

intrachromosomally (not comparable)

  1. Within a chromosome.
    • 2015 September 9, Natasha M. Glover et al., “Small-scale gene duplications played a major role in the recent evolution of wheat chromosome 3B”, in Genome Biology[1], volume 16, →DOI:
      Recombination as well as gene density increases with relative distance from the centromere, and intrachromosomally duplicated genes are found more frequently at the distal regions of the chromosome.
